CA PPM Upgrade fails with error on DWH_INV_SECURITY.xml
search cancel

CA PPM Upgrade fails with error on DWH_INV_SECURITY.xml

book

Article ID: 5089

calendar_today

Updated On:

Products

Clarity PPM SaaS Clarity PPM On Premise

Issue/Introduction

CA PPM Upgrade to 14.4 or higher version fails when upgraded from 14.3.0.9 (14.3 Patch 9) and fails with error in install.log

 

Process - table: DWH_INV_SECURITY.xml 

11/16/16 9:51 PM (admin) com.ca.clarity.jdbc.oraclebase.ddc: [CA Clarity][Oracle JDBC Driver][Oracle]ORA-01702: a view is not appropriate here 

11/16/16 9:51 PM (admin) at com.ca.clarity.jdbc.oraclebase.dde3.k(Unknown Source) 

11/16/16 9:51 PM (admin) at com.ca.clarity.jdbc.oraclebase.dde3.a(Unknown Source) 

11/16/16 9:51 PM (admin) at com.ca.clarity.jdbc.oraclebase.dde3.executeBatch(Unknown Source) 

11/16/16 9:51 PM (admin) at com.ca.clarity.jdbc.oraclebase.dde5.executeBatch(Unknown Source) 

11/16/16 9:51 PM (admin)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) 

11/16/16 9:51 PM (admin)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) 

11/16/16 9:51 PM (admin)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) 

11/16/16 9:51 PM (admin) at java.lang.reflect.Method.invoke(Method.java:497) 

11/16/16 9:51 PM (admin) at org.logicalcobwebs.proxool.ProxyStatement.invoke(ProxyStatement.java:68) 

11/16/16 9:51 PM (admin) at org.logicalcobwebs.cglib.proxy.Proxy$ProxyImpl$$EnhancerByCGLIB$$25b04b8e.executeBatch(<generated>) 

11/16/16 9:51 PM (admin) at com.niku.dbtools.Utilities.executeAndCommitSql(Utilities.java:2736) 

11/16/16 9:51 PM (admin) at com.niku.dbtools.DriverApp.apply(DriverApp.java:1493) 

11/16/16 9:51 PM (admin) at com.niku.dbtools.DriverApp.installSchemaDriver(DriverApp.java:713) 

11/16/16 9:51 PM (admin) at com.niku.dbtools.Utilities.run(Utilities.java:1862) 

11/16/16 9:51 PM (admin) at com.niku.dbtools.Utilities.main(Utilities.java:975) 

11/16/16 9:51 PM (admin) SQL Text: 

11/16/16 9:51 PM (admin) CREATE INDEX DWH_INV_SECURITY_N2 ON DWH_INV_SECURITY ( USER_UID, GLOBAL_VIEW_RIGHT, PERMISSION_KEY ) TABLESPACE US51751tDWH_PPMDWH_INDX 

11/16/16 9:51 PM (admin) CREATE INDEX DWH_INV_SECURITY_N3 ON DWH_INV_SECURITY ( USER_UID, GLOBAL_VIEW_RIGHT, INVESTMENT_KEY ) TABLESPACE US51751tDWH_PPMDWH_INDX 

11/16/16 9:51 PM (admin) CREATE INDEX DWH_INV_SECURITY_N4 ON DWH_INV_SECURITY ( PERMISSION_KEY, SYS_OP_C2C(USER_UID) ) TABLESPACE US51751tDWH_PPMDWH_INDX 

11/16/16 9:51 PM (admin) CREATE INDEX DWH_INV_SECURITY_N5 ON DWH_INV_SECURITY ( INVESTMENT_KEY, SYS_OP_C2C(USER_UID) ) TABLESPACE US51751tDWH_PPMDWH_INDX 

11/16/16 9:51 PM (admin) Note: Foreign Keys and Triggers have been enabled 

11/16/16 9:51 PM (admin) DBDriver failed to install! 

Environment

CA PPM 14.4 & higher

Cause

The DWH security design was changed from table to view at this patch and hence its giving the error.

Resolution

If you on CA PPM 14.3.0.9 (14.3 Patch 9) then before upgrading to 14.4 or higher version, please apply 14.3.0.10 (14.3 Patch 10)